Project Brief | The Purpose of this project activity is to generate electricity by harnessing the solar energy by using of solar photovoltaic technology and there by wheeling the generated electricity to the premises of. Project activity involves installation of a 13.17 MW solar project in the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an. The project is being implemented in Al- Madounah / Amman Capital of Jordan via a SPV by Royal Hashemite Court. |
---|---|
Additional Information | The project will replace anthropogenic emissions of greenhouse gases (GHG’s) estimated to be approximately 12,625 tCO2e/year, thereon displacing estimated average of 27,969 MWh/year amount of electricity from the generation-mix of power plants connected to the Jordanian grid, which is mainly dominated by thermal/fossil fuel-based power plant. Project activity will mitigate the total GHG emission reductions of 126,251 tCO2e over the entire crediting period. |
